Koreans married 386 Mongolian women in 2009

Statistics Korea said 33,300 South Koreans tied the knot with foreigners in 2009, accounting for 10.8 percent of all marriages in the country. It marks a big increase from 4,710, or 1.2 percent, in 1990 but a decline from 42,356, or 13.5 percent, in 2005.

Chinese and Vietnamese brides were the most popular, numbering 11,364 and 7,249 respectively. The number of Mongolian wives stood at 386, lower than Filipino brides (1,643), Japanese (1,140), Cambodians (851), Thais (496), and the US (416), but higher than Uzbekistani (365) and Nepalese (316).
